Selection of kinematic structure for portable machine tool

Abstract: Selection of kinematic structure for portable machine tool The article presents the problem of selecting kinematic structures for the proposed portable machine tool. Developed methodology of selection has been based on the detailed design requirements and elimination conditions formulated thanks to them. The paper describes the program developed to assist the process of selecting the kinematic structures for the portable machine tool and the results achieved.
